Definitions:

Perceptual Organization

The cognitive process by which the brain structures sensory input into meaningful patterns or objects.

Perceptual Constancy

The accurate perception of certain attributes of a distal object, such as its shape, size, and brightness, despite changes in the proximal stimulus caused by variations in our viewing circumstances.

Serial Processing

The act of handling one piece of information at a time, typically in a sequential manner.

Size Constancy

is the perceptual ability to see objects as maintaining the same size despite changes in their distance or the size of the image they cast on the retina.
